Job Description:
A vacancy exists for a Registered Nurse - Psychiatry, based at a private hospital reporting to the, Nursing Manager. The successful candidate will be responsible for ensuring delivery of uncompromising quality care in line with Company strategic objectives and applicable Health /Nursing legislation.
Requirements:
- General Nursing and Psychiatry Degree / Diploma
- Registration with SANC
- Senior Certificate
- Relevant experience and technical skill to meet the critical outputs
- Understanding of the private healthcare industry, its challenges and role players would be an advantage
- Computer proficiency would be an advantage
